Overview
The story follows a family of five, living quietly and away from prying eyes on the Izu Islands—including the youngest daughter, born invisible. Their mother, who had raised her cheerfully, has passed away from illness, and their anxious father has devoted himself to hiding his daughters from the world. One day, however, they must set out on a journey to visit their grandmother, a famous actress living in Tokyo.

Who directed The Invisibles?
The Invisibles was directed by Ryo Takebayashi.
Where was The Invisibles produced?
It was produced by companies including PARCO, CHOCOLATE, Tokyu Agency in Japan.
